parser

Написать ответ на текущее сообщение

 

 
   команды управления поиском

Ответ

MoKo 13.03.2013 01:33

Какая максимальная длина двоичного числа? Судя по результату - 3 байта.
4 байта, 32 бита.
Сложно ли сделать длиннее? Мне нужно более 40 бит.
К сожалению, не на всех OS есть встроенные типы длиннее 32 бит. :(

Так что боюсь руками, если надо только складывать, то относительно просто. Берете младшие 24 бита (24 символа) и остальное, каждую часть складываете и использованием math::convert. Если после складывания младших частей длина стала 25 символов, символ отрезаете, старшую часть увеличиваете на 1. Строки складываете.
ps. Вероятно я перемудрил и лучше использовать строки.
Мне кажется проще комбинированный подход, или вы собираетесь их складывать как строки? :)